In any systematic study the number of characters used to generate the phylogenetic inference needs to be maximized. At the same time homo-plasy or convergence of characters needs to be minimized. mtDNA genes for systematic studies should take both of these factors into consideration. [Pg.179]

Paradoxical as it may sound, by far the most important factor in inferring phytogenies is not the method of phylogenetic inference but the quality of the input data. The importance of data selection and in particular of the alignment process caimot be overestimated. Even the most sophisticated phylogenetic inference methods are not able to correct for erroneous input data. [Pg.356]
